Let's make this process a little better with the "Alex needs a better way to spend his free time lunch picker!"
Directions:
Note: Adding Grand Junction more that once will improve it's odds. Why... because it turns out eliminating duplicates is more difficult to code than I thought... and it's 1:33am.
Note: I feel like I also need to say this is sudo random. As a purely random algorithm is not possible; well maybe with the help of an AI, but that didn't work out very well for John Connor.